Hi guys, I recently downloaded a BIM that is a .rte file of a garden roof: http://resources.hydrotechusa.com/resources.php?category=BIM it's the garden roof assembly intensive file
So, basicly I have no idea how to use it in my project. Can I convert it into a rfa file and use it as a roof.
I'm using Revit 2015 with latest updates.

all you need to do is to open up the rte file that has the roof type in it. it already has a roof sample drawn in the file so just select it and copy it. then open up the project you want to use the new roof family in and paste it in. it will bring over the roof family type which you can now use for any roof. it will also bring over any of the materials and fill patterns that are used.
